Changing environmental attitudes, job engagement, an aging workforce, new technologies … these are just a few things affecting the energy workforce today.  

A recent survey of global energy industry recruiters and workers reflects these shifts, indicating their importance for all energy producers, from oil and gas to renewable energy. It’s becoming clear how crucial it is for the energy companies to focus on professional development opportunities and training to strengthen engagement and retention in response to these trends.

Introducing Enverus Learning and Development

Enverus is launching a Learning and Development Program in response to these market changes. The continuing education program offers five different learning options for energy professionals to grow their understanding of how to effectively use Enverus solutions and stay current on industry trends. The options include certifications, learning sites, live webinars, education resources and onboarding.

“At Enverus, we’ve always focused on trying to partner with our customers and understand their biggest challenges. This drives the roadmap of what we develop. Over the last three years, we’ve heard more and more about three related challenges: attracting new talent, helping existing workforces become skilled with new technologies and retaining employees. Helping them meet these challenges is why Enverus developed our Learning and Development Program,” said Jimmy Fortuna, chief product officer at Enverus.

Why professional development matters

Energy is always changing, and today, many companies rely on technology that provides advanced data, analytics and technical workflows to make data-based decisions about their business. Professionals need to adjust to these changes by learning new skills and techniques or risk everyday inefficiency at their jobs or career stagnation. Also, new graduates with less work experience might find it difficult to find a job in the industry.

Enverus learning and development helps industry professionals stay on top of trends by educating them on new Enverus PRISM® workflows that help them do their day-to-day work more efficiently. Graduates can benefit from Enverus certifications to stand out amid the competition.
Employee training also benefits leaders. Professional development programs increase employee retention, engagement, technology adoption and productivity, helping a company realize maximum value from technology investments.

More about Learning and Development options

Below are more details about the available options with Enverus’ Learning and Development Program:

  • Certifications offer industry professionals the opportunity to master skills and acquire deeper knowledge of the Enverus PRISM platform. Learners complete a rigorous continuing education program, with different certification levels to learn how to work efficiently to generate their daily workflows, provide better insights and understand how to integrate PRISM within their teams. The certifications are great for professionals already in the industry to level up their skills, people looking to transition into the industry or college graduates looking to distinguish their resume from others in the job market.
  • Learning sites offer company-branded sites that provide employees the skills and knowledge needed to empower the business to compete in the industry today. Each site allows for the organization to provide a dedicated experience to their employee base to show professional growth and development opportunities.
  • Live training webinars are available to all PRISM customers with four sessions offered monthly!
  • Education content, including a large PRISM workbook library, on-demand webinars, and other on-demand training, keeps PRISM users on the cutting edge of key industry topics and shows them how to perform these workflows in PRISM.
  • Onboarding includes on-demand PRISM onboarding training courses for new or existing users of Enverus ®FOUNDATIONS and Enverus ®CORE, two of the most popular PRISM packages offered by Enverus.
